Worcester Avenue is in Wheatley, Doncaster and in Doncaster district. DN2 4HW is located in the Wheatley Hills & Intake elect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Doncaster Central.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Worcester Avenue was 216.3 per 1,000 residents, which is 31.8% lower than the Town average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Worcester Avenue has the 7th highest crime rate of 31 local areas in Town and the 158th highest crime rate of 1,002 local areas in Doncaster .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 81.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-12.5%.
